HP has been on a journey to drive greater supply chain efficiencies while continuing to leverage its competitive advantage of a responsive, integrated, and profitable approach to supply planning and customer fulfillment. With a customer-centric approach to supply chain operations, HP is innovating new ways to segment and serve a broad set of customer requirements.
Hear how HP is driving new levels of planning effectiveness by using priority-based planning scenarios to make profitable decisions that maintain customer satisfaction. Learn how HP increased the level of confidence in the commits made back to customers - based on true supplier inventory availability, capacity, and the overall ability to fulfill demand on time. It achieved this even while facing the challenges of unpredictable demand variability, and a global outsourced supply chain network where supply is not often under the company's control.
In this videocast, we will look at the strategies HP deploys to meet its customers' delivery expectations in the critical time frames that matter - such as at the end of the quarter, when both constraints and bluebirds can present an upside for supply chain responsiveness to opportunities.
At the same time, HP is moving supporting supply chain technologies to the cloud for a secure and resilient approach to managing its operations. Hear how HP is enabling the cloud to be a key platform for supply chain technologies to meet the challenge of orchestrating its global outsourced supply chain under rapidly changing market conditions.
